La Web del Programador: Comunidad de Programadores
 
    Pregunta:  51983 - PROBLEMAS CON DECIMALES AL ACTUALIZAR UNA TABLA ORACLE
Autor:  Jerónimo Rueda Perez
Cuando intento actualizar en una tabla (oracle en mi caso) a traves de la rejilla de datos del administrador de BD de PowerBuilder 6.5, un valor decimal, si le pongo una coma como separador me da un error de numero invalido, y si le pongo un punto si actualiza el valor pero lo considera como un separador de unidades de millar.
Al definir la conexion a la base de datos con un profile, he puesto el
parametro SQLCA.DBParm = "DecimalSeparator=','" .
A traves de aplicación no me ha sucedido este problema, y solo me sucede desde el Aministrador de BD.

  Respuesta:  Jose Cárdenas
Has probado a poner una mascara al campo?, ponle la siguiente mascara #,##0.00, poniendo mascara te despreocupas de comas y puntos. En caso de te siga fallando prueba en el reginonal setting de windows, y mira que tienes puesto como separador de decimales y de miles.

suerte